The Meghalaya state government has officially declared a state disaster after intense thunderstorms and strong winds battered the region.
Intense thunderstorms accompanied by strong winds swept across Meghalaya, causing widespread disruption. Meteorological agencies reported that the weather system produced heavy rainfall and gusts strong enough to damage structures and uproot trees.
In response to the escalating situation, the state government issued a formal declaration of a state disaster, invoking emergency protocols under the State Disaster Management Act. The declaration enables the mobilisation of state resources and coordination with central agencies for relief operations.
Authorities have alerted district administrations to prepare for rescue and relief activities, including the deployment of medical teams, restoration of power, and provision of temporary shelters for affected residents. The government has also urged the public to stay indoors, avoid travel on vulnerable roads, and follow safety advisories issued by officials.
